Wiktionary
CASTRATE, verb. (transitive) To remove the testicles of.
CASTRATE, verb. (transitive) To remove the ovaries of.
Dictionary definition
CASTRATE, noun. A man who has been castrated and is incapable of reproduction; "eunuchs guarded the harem".
CASTRATE, verb. Deprive of strength or vigor; "The Senate emasculated the law".
CASTRATE, verb. Edit by omitting or modifying parts considered indelicate; "bowdlerize a novel".
CASTRATE, verb. Remove the testicles of a male animal.
CASTRATE, verb. Remove the ovaries of; "Is your cat spayed?".
